Output a9030ef4ba59f34fcdc21253a0af846c180edd9c66570d4e66f61fd35981bf02:1

value
639331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3752462820ec4b10831e1695f37764a4e4e5e584 OP_EQUAL
address
36jXebVwEZReAnaCu529Prjxp47A5MQQb2
transaction
a9030ef4ba59f34fcdc21253a0af846c180edd9c66570d4e66f61fd35981bf02
confirmations
428396
spent
true